The attached condition(s) is/are to be fulfilled and implemented prior to subsequent issuance of a permit or other grant of approval for development of the property. This certificate relates only to issues of compliance or noncompliance with the Subdivision Map Act and local ordinances enacted pursuant thereto. The parcel described herein may be sold, leased, or financed without further compliance with the Subdivision Map Act or any local ordinance enacted pursuant thereto. This Certificate of Compliance does not grant the right to develop the parcel. Development of the parcel may require issuance of a permit or permits, or other grant or grants of approval. Prior to issuance of building permits, plans specifying the required structural materials for building construction in high fire hazard severity zones shall be submitted to the Fire Prevention Bureau for approval. (CFC, 4905) 2. Prior to issuance of Building Permits, plans for structural protection from vegetation fires shall be submitted to the Fire Prevention Bureau for review and approval. Measures shall include, but are not limited to: noncombustible barriers (cement or block walls), fuel modification zones, etc. (CFC Chapter 49) 080 -Fire. 2 Prior to permit Not Satisfied 1. Secondary access may be required per California Fire Code (503.12.) 2. Prior to construction, "private" driveways over 150 feet in length shall have a turn -around as determined by the Fire Prevention Bureau capable of accommodating fire apparatus. Driveway grades shall not exceed 12 percent. (CFC 503,CFC 501.4) 3. Prior to issuance of the building permit for development, independent paved (or otherwise approved) access to the nearest road, maintained by the County shall be designed and constructed by the responsible party or applicant within the public right of way in accordance with County Standards. (CFC 501.4) 4. Prior to construction, all locations where structures are to be built shall have an approved Fire Department access based on standards approved by the Office of the Fire Marshal. (CFC 501.4) 080 -Fire. 3 Prior to permit Not Satisfied 1. Prior to issuance of Building Permits, the applicant/developer shall furnish one copy of the water system plans to the Office of the Fire Marshal for review. The required water system, including fire hydrants and/or water storage tanks, shall be installed, made serviceable, and be accepted by the Office of the Fire Marshal prior to beginning construction. They shall be maintained accessible. 2. Existing fire hydrants on public streets are allowed to be considered available. Existing fire hydrants on adjacent properties shall not be considered available unless fire apparatus access roads extend between properties and easements are established to prevent obstruction of such roads.
